    If I don’t buy the not so scary Halloween tickets plan to visit Magic Kingdom on that day what time are the fireworks that we are able to see? Do we lose out on the fireworks and have a shorter time in the park on those days?

    So, you're planning to visit Magic Kingdom on a night when Mickey’s Not-So-Scary Halloween Party is happening, but don’t have a party ticket? If this is the case, I wanted to let you know that when the clock strikes 6:00 PM, the regular park day wraps up and the BOO-rific party begins. That includes the Not-So-Spooky Spectacular fireworks, which are only viewable from inside the park if you have a special event ticket. Unfortunately, this would mean you would not be able to experience fireworks that night at Magic Kingdom. 

    But don’t let that rain on your pixie dust! You’ll still have an incredible day filled with rides, snacks, characters, and daytime enchantment galore. If fireworks are a must-do for you (and who doesn’t love ending a Disney day with a bang?), would it be possible to plan your Magic Kingdom day on a non-party night? That way, you get the whole experience—including the classic Happily Ever After fireworks—and don’t have to head out early.

    OR… if your heart is set on Halloween fun and you’re curious about trick-or-treating in the park, rare character sightings, and that special fireworks show, it might be worth grabbing those party tickets after all.
